The New Jatco JF015E: When is a CVT not a CVT?

The CVT (continuously variable transmission) concept has been around forever, but CVTs have been on the road now for decades, in one form or another. Although there are several different models of CVT, they all have one thing in common: basic operation.

Over the years there have been variations in CVTs from vehicle model to model, starting with the original DAF European CVTs, up to the first Jatco CVT, Saturn VT20E, ZF VT1, Ford CFT30 and then on to later-model Jatcos. There are CVTs that use a torque converter and some that don’t. A CVT may have a push belt, while others use a drive chain. Electrical components also vary widely among models. In addition, certain models use a direct-drive pump while others use a chain-driven remote pump. The CFT30 uses a pump with oscillating pistons. A CVT will also have a planetary gear set, primarily for reverse.

JR710E RWD 7-Speed: RE5R05A plus parts/minus parts

Jatco, a Japanese transmission manufacturer, has for decades produced a variety of transmissions, and although Nissan and Subaru have been the largest consumers, several car companies use its products.

In recent years, the focus of Jatco has leaned toward CVTs (continuously variable transmissions); however, the company has always produced step-type transmissions – from simple three-speed automatics all the way up the food chain to seven-speed transmissions, like the JR710E/711E.

Jatco also launched a hybrid version of the JR710E, coded JR712E, in 2011. The JR712E concept is somewhat in line with the GM 2ML70 hybrid.
